Historical Context: The 25 Centimes coin of 1920 was issued by the Commune of Saint-Gaudens, a municipality in southwestern France. This post-World War I era saw numerous French communes issue "monnaie de nécessité" to alleviate severe shortages of small denomination national currency. The Third Republic permitted these local initiatives, facilitating daily commerce during a period of economic disruption and reconstruction.

Technical/Grading: Struck in aluminium, a relatively soft metal, this 25 Centimes piece measures 30 mm and weighs 2.3 grams. Aluminium coins are prone to exhibiting bag marks and surface abrasions, even at higher grades. Key high-points for wear assessment typically include the highest relief elements of any central motif and the edges of lettering. Due to their emergency nature and often less robust minting processes, these local issues can display variable strike quality, with some examples showing flatness or incomplete detail.
